Multimodal Vigilance Estimation Using Deep Learning.

Wei Wu, Wei Sun, Q M Jonathan Wu

    IEEE Transactions on Cybernetics
    |October 7, 2020
    PubMed
    Summary
    This summary is machine-generated.

    Accurate vigilance estimation is crucial for public transport safety. A new multimodal network using forehead electrooculography and electroencephalography significantly improves detection of awake, tired, and drowsy states.

    Area of Science:

    • Neuroscience
    • Transportation Safety
    • Machine Learning

    Background:

    • Reduced vigilance is a growing cause of accidents, particularly in public transportation.
    • Accurate estimation of vigilance is essential for enhancing safety in transportation systems.
    • Current methods for vigilance estimation require improvement in accuracy and reliability.

    Purpose of the Study:

    • To propose and evaluate a novel multimodal regression network for accurate vigilance estimation.
    • To assess the effectiveness of the proposed network using electroencephalography and electrooculography features.
    • To demonstrate the benefits of feature fusion for improved vigilance state classification.

    Main Methods:

    • Development of a multimodal regression network: multichannel deep autoencoders with subnetwork neurons (MCDAEsn).
    • Utilizing forehead electrooculography (fEEG) and electroencephalography (EEG) as input modalities.
    • Implementing feature fusion of fEEG and EEG data to capture complementary information.

    Main Results:

    • The MCDAEsn model achieved high accuracy in distinguishing between awake, tired, and drowsy states based on eye closure percentages (0-0.35, 0.36-0.70, 0.71-1).
    • Single modality application showed promising results, validating the core network architecture.
    • Multimodal fusion of fEEG and EEG features significantly enhanced the performance compared to single modalities, demonstrating method effectiveness.

    Conclusions:

    • The proposed MCDAEsn network offers an effective and efficient solution for accurate vigilance estimation.
    • Multimodal data fusion, particularly combining fEEG and EEG, substantially improves the performance of vigilance monitoring systems.
    • This approach holds significant potential for enhancing safety in public transportation by proactively identifying and mitigating risks associated with reduced vigilance.
